Original Recipe Yield 1 - 9 inch pie
 

Ingredients

  • 1 (4 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
  • 1 (16 ounce) package silken tofu
  • 5 tablespoons un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la
  • 2 tablespoons coffee flavored liqueur
  • 1/4 teaspoon orange oil
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 5 teaspoons cider vinegar
  • 1/4 cup mini chocolate chips
  • 1 (9 inch) unbaked pie crust

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  2. In a large bowl, using an electric mixer or stand mixer, whip the cream cheese and tofu until smooth. Add the cocoa powder, sugar, vanilla, coffee liqueur, orange oil, honey, and vinegar; beat until smooth. Fold in half of the chocolate chips, then pour the batter into the pie shell, sprinkle with the remaining chocolate chips.
  3. Bake in preheated oven until set, about 25 minutes. Cool to room temperature and then refrigerate until cold before serving, at least 4 hours.
